Enrichment Characteristics Of Organic Matter In The Chang 7 Oil Shale Section In Triassic Yanchang Formation In Southern Margin Of Ordos Basin

This paper takes the southern part of the Ordos Basin?the Weibei uplift area and the southern part of the northern slope of Shaanxi?as the research area.After the first national oil shale resource evaluation,it confirmed that the oil shale resources are abundant.This paper mainly studies the characteristics of oil shale and the characteristics of organic matter enrichment in the study area.Oil shale formations in the study area were formed in the Ordos Basin during the Middle-Late Triassic Yanchang Formation,which was the largest flooding period in the Ordos Basin.On the basis of previous data collection,this paper studied the organic matter enrichment characteristics of the Chang 7 oil shale in the target area of the study area through field surveys,measured profiles,core observations,sample collection,and test analysis.This study enriches the Ordos Basin.The metallogenic model and resource evaluation of oil shale in the Triassic Yanchang Formation are of great significance.The color of the oil shale in the study area is grayish black and grayish brown,with horizontal bedding,low hardness and greasy sheen.The main minerals of oil shale and shale are terrigenous clastic minerals and clay minerals.The terrigenous detrital minerals are mainly quartz,the clay minerals are mainly Eimeng and illite;the shale and oil shale contain pyrite,and the pyrite content in the oil shale is much higher shale;the trace element content of oil shale and mud shale is significantly enriched in Mo;the oil shale has high organic matter abundance and is an excellent source rock,the organic matter types are type I and type II1,and in the low maturation-immature stage.It is of great significance for enriching the metallogenic model and resource evaluation of the oil shale of the Triassic Yanchang Formation in the Ordos Basin.Based on a detailed observation of the core of the fully coring wells and analysis of logging data,the Yanchang Formation?chang6-chang10?is divided into three third-order sequences?Sequence I,II,and III?.The lower part of chang 9,chang 10,and chang 8 is the sequence I,the upper part of chang 7 and chang 8 is the sequence II,and chang 6 is a part of the sequence III.In the Yanchang Formation of the study area,there are mainly lacustrine,delta and turbidite deposits.Among them,the lake facies recognizes three kinds of sedimentary microfacies:shallow sands,muddy shallow lakes,and semi-deep lake-deep lake mudstone.The delta facies identified four sedimentary microfacies of underwater distributary channels,interchannels,estuary dams,and sheet sands.Visible fossils,fish manure fossils and plant stems and plant leaf fossils are visible in the formation.The sequence II in the study area is the main development stratum of oil shale.Comprehensive analysis of the TOC and rock pyrolysis data of the ZK903 well and the He 3 well sequence II show that the organic matter abundance of the HST is the highest,the organic matter type is the best,and the organic matter type II1 is the best.Mainly,with a small amount of type I and type II;followed by RST and TST,dominated by type II1 and type II organic matter;the worst was LST,mainly type II2 organic matter.Through studying the distribution characteristics of organic matter in the sequence stratigraphic framework of this area,we can see that the organic matter in the oil shale section is mainly concentrated in the HST of sequence II,and a small amount is in RST and LST.Among them,HST develops semi-deep lake-deep lacustrine deposits,the most abundant and developed organic shale with good quality;RST and LST developed semi-deep lakes-deep lacustrine lakes and muddy shallow lake deposits,with a rich organic matter.Poor and poor quality oil shale developed in RST.The characteristics of the sedimentary tectonic evolution in the comprehensive study area and the ratio of TOC and trace elements in the extension group from 6 to 10were found in the vertical change.In the drastic phase of the depression in the lake basin,the overall basement was unbalanced and the depression was subsidence under the palaeotectonics.Warm and moist palaeoclimate conditions,semi-deep lakes-deep lake sedimentary environments,and reduced freshwater paleolake water conditions are conducive to the enrichment of organic matter.
